Mine is the Focal Clear Mg. They don't sound "bad" per se, just somewhat boring and average. Are they better than my Elex? Sure, but only marginally. When I put them up against anything else I own in their weight class, they just don't hold up. The soundstage is small, the imaging is lackluster - like a slightly better version of the HD600 three blob effect. The midrange doesn't wow me like my Atriums or my Auteur. The high end isn't as precise as my sticker modded 8XX. The subbass doesn't extend as far as my LCD-X, let alone my LCD-3, though the bass impact is definitely the real deal. In all honesty they just feel like a musical palette cleanser, and I do use them as such when I'm trying out a new pair of headphones, but for over a grand, I was hoping they'd stand out more than they do.
Part of me wants to get a Utopia just to see if it's just the Clear/Elear line or if Focal's house tuning really is that boring, but I'm not very enticed by the idea of spending another 2 or 3 grand just to experience another, marginally better version of the Clear, which is only marginally better than the Elex.
